Fox News didn't care about its lies -- until the truth of a billion-dollar lawsuit got its attention

Sean Hannity of Fox “News” asked that question of Ted Koppel four years ago as the latter was interviewing him on “CBS Sunday Morning.” Yes, answered Koppel, “because you’re very good at what you do and . . . you have attracted people who are determined that ideology is more important than facts.”

Thus dressed down, Hannity smirked and made a face. He later asserted that Koppel — 1992 inductee into the Television Academy Hall of Fame, winner of nine Peabody Awards and 25 Emmys for journalistic excellence — is “not a journalist.” His echo chamber promptly echoed him. Laura Ingraham called him a “victim.” Michelle Malkin derided Koppel as “a walking dead decrepit media elitist.”

Anyone naive enough to believe Koppel’s exercise in speaking truth to falsity might chasten Hannity and other facts-impervious right-wing pundits was thus duly educated. What do they care? They’ve been dressed down by a thousand Ted Koppels for their utter indifference to truth and the damage it’s inflicted upon this country. They’ve happily ignored it all. But now comes something they can’t ignore, and it means business — literally.

Consider that, in December, Fox and Newsmax ran extraordinary segments debunking bogus claims made by their own hosts and guests against Smartmatic, a provider of election technology, over its supposed role in supposed voter fraud. This came after threatening letters from Smartmatic attorneys. Last week, the company filed a $2.7 billion defamation suit against Fox, two of its guests (Donald Trump lawyers Rudy Giuliani and Sidney Powell) and three of its hosts (Lou Dobbs, Maria Bartiromo and Jeanine Pirro).
